The property the test is asserting is "exactly one `ScannerNext` RPC fires for a paged scan, regardless of `hbase.meta.scanner.caching`." That isn't really a property of `MetaTableAccessor` in isolation — it's an emergent property of `ClientScanner` + `ScannerCallable` + the RegionServer responding to the scan's `caching`/`limit`, and `ScanMetrics.countOfRPCcalls` is incremented inside that machinery on real responses. Two mock-based shapes I considered, both of which seem to weaken the test: 1. Capture the `Scan` and assert `scan.getCaching() == rowLimit`. This restates the one-line fix in `getMetaScan` and wouldn't catch a future regression where caching is set correctly but the client-side batching contract changes. 2. Hand-roll a fake `ResultScanner` that simulates `ScannerNext` batching from `caching`/`limit`. That re-implements the contract we're verifying inside the test fake and asserts our fake matches our expectation — feels tautological. If you see a shape I missed that preserves the RPC-count assertion without a cluster, I'd be happy to switch. Otherwise I'd lean toward keeping this as an integration test. -- This is an automated message from the Apache Git Service.
